HRC Mourns Serenity Hollis, Black Transgender Woman Killed in Albany, Georgia

HRC Mourns Serenity Hollis, Black Transgender Woman Killed in Albany, Georgia HRC is deeply saddened to learn of the death of Serenity Hollis, a 24-year-old Black transgender woman who was shot and killed in Albany, Georgia, on May 8, 2021. Serenity’s death is at least the 25th violent death of a transgender or gender non-conforming person in 2021. We say “at least” because too often these deaths go unreported or misreported. According to social media, Serenity was from Orlando, Florida, and moved to Albany, Georgia, in 2019. Serenity’s mother Robyn Osberry said that “the person that’s responsible has no idea what they took from us.I absolutely want to see that justice is served.”

HRC Mourns Sophie Vásquez, Latina Transgender Woman Killed in Georgia

HRC Mourns Sophie Vásquez, Latina Transgender Woman Killed in Georgia HRC is deeply saddened to learn of the death of Sophie Vásquez, a 36-year-old Latina transgender woman who was shot and killed in Brookhaven, Georgia, on May 4. HRC is deeply saddened to learn of the death of Sophie Vásquez, a 36-year-old Latina transgender woman who was shot and killed in Brookhaven, Georgia, on May 4. Her death is at least the 23rd violent death of a transgender or gender non-conforming person in 2021. We say “at least” because too often these deaths go unreported or misreported. According to El Nuevo Georgia, Sophie was a part of the EsTr (El / La) Community, or Community Estrella, a community that works to support transgender people in the Atlanta area. The Community has organized a vigil, to be held on May 12, in honor of Sophie. HRC Mourns Remy Fennell, Black Transgender Woman Killed in North Carolina

HRC Mourns Remy Fennell, Black Transgender Woman Killed in North Carolina The Human Rights Campaign is deeply saddened to learn of the death of Remy Fennell, also known on Facebook and in her work hair styling as Remy Kreations, a Black transgender woman in her 20s, who was shot to death on April 15 in Charlotte, N.C. Her death is at least the 15th violent death of a transgender or gender non-conforming person in 2021. We say “at least” because too often these deaths go unreported or misreported. Remy’s death is also the second death of a Black transgender woman in Charlotte in the last two weeks, after Jaida Peterson was killed on April 4.

HRC Mourns Diamond Kyree Sanders, Black Transgender Woman Killed in Cincinnati

HRC Mourns Diamond Kyree Sanders, Black Transgender Woman Killed in Cincinnati HRC is deeply saddened to learn of the death of Diamond Kyree Sanders, a 23-year-old Black transgender woman who was shot to death in Cincinnati, Ohio on March 3. Her death is at least the 11th violent death of a transgender or non-binary person in 2021. We say “at least” because too often these deaths go unreported or misreported. Diamond was described by a family member on social media as “beloved.” An obituary shared by her family describes many loving memories. “She valued her family and enjoyed spending time with them. As a child, she would say ‘I love my WHOLE family!’,” the obituary states. “As an adult, Diamond was a traveler, known to be in New York City one week and New Orleans the following week. Diamond was really into fashion… Diamond’s unique style, charm and personality will be greatly missed.”
